About Oregon Traveling Dentist

  Annual guarantee of $180k, non-production pay for performance compensation plan.

  Offering a generous new hire total compensation package which includes, but is not limited to:

  Paid time off, holiday pay, 401K, medical, dental, vision, life, disability, license reimbursement and continuing education funds.Willamette Dental Group seeks a General Dentist who incorporates empathy, kindness and a patient-centered care delivery approach with every patient. It’s what we are known for, and how we have built our reputation of having providers and offices rated very highly on patient satisfaction surveys. For more information visit www.willamettedental.com/careers .

  We are a group of providers and a dental insurance carrier. As an Accountable Care Organization you’ll focus on engaging your patient through education so that you will positively impact their overall health.

  Our evidence-based scientific approach allows you to focus on the necessary treatment for your patients. No production goals, quotas or pressure to sell dentistry.

  You’ll work in a collaborative environment with multiple General Dentists and Specialists, as well as receive mentorship and/or provide mentorship to others as you grow in your position.

  You’ll work with a highly trained team of patient care advocates, dental hygienists, and dental assistants, utilizing them to their fullest scope of practice (per state requirements).

  You’ll have freedom to diagnose and treatment plan your own cases.

  Job Qualifications

  Education and Experience:

  DDS or DMD from an accredited dental university.

  General Practice Residency OR Advanced Education in General Dentistry preferred.

  Active state license and BLS.

  Nitrous Oxide credentials required.

  Company Overview

  We provide:

  A stable, dentist-owned private company with an eye on the future.

  Excellent benefits including:

  Paid time off

  401k $1 for $1 match up to 5% of your compensation or the IRS limit for 401(k) contributions, whichever comes first

  Medical, dental, life and disability insurances

  Tuition reimbursement

  A culture of inclusivity and respect in line with our core values of health, compassion, innovation and integrity.

  Supportive community outreach dollars and encouragement to volunteer.

  Thorough employee orientation and onboarding.

  We are:

  A provider and employer of choice in the Northwest for 50 years.

  Dental insurance + providers in over 50 general and specialty offices in OR, WA and ID.

  Dedicated to proactive care to facilitate the best possible outcomes.

  Willamette Dental Group is an equal opportunity employer.

  We evaluate qualified candidates without regard to race, color, religion, sex, national origin, veteran status and other protected characteristics.
